TECHNICAL AND VOLUMETRIC STRUCTURE
Alphabet (GOOGL) is currently trading at $346.77, up slightly 0.22% intraday after a -4.99% drop yesterday on high volume of 41.1 million shares, signaling institutional selling pressure. The stock is trading below its 20-day Simple Moving Average (SMA20) located at $355.90, confirming a BEARISH short-term momentum. However, the price remains comfortably above the 200-day SMA (SMA200) at $321.34, suggesting an underlying BULLISH trend. The RSI(14) is at 55.25, indicating NEUTRAL momentum. Key support levels are identified at $330.20 (1-month) and $271.95 (6-month), while resistances are at $376.00 (1-month) and $408.37 (6-month). The 20-day performance of -4.7% and underperformance relative to the XLC sector over the same period (-7.1 points) highlight recent relative weakness, despite a 3-month outperformance (+9.4 points).
